A Glimpse into Barcelona B FC’s Past

Inaugurated in 1970, Barcelona B FC was built to cultivate and expose young talents to the professional football scene. It has since evolved into a critical pillar for FC Barcelona, one of the most triumphant clubs globally.

The Role and Objective of Barcelona B FC

As a second team, Barcelona B FC serves a crucial purpose in fostering talents. Competing in Spain’s Segunda Division B, it offers young prospects a taste of professional football, equipping them for the demands and hurdles of top-tier football.

Barcelona B FC’s Talent Development

The discussion of Barcelona B FC would be incomplete without highlighting its unmatched record in talent grooming. La Masia, its youth system, has produced a plethora of football giants. Stars like Lionel Messi, Andres Iniesta, and Xavi Hernandez owe their growth to their tenure at Barcelona B FC.

Prominent Successes of Barcelona B FC

Barcelona B FC‘s distinguished history boasts several notable accomplishments. The team has clinched countless titles at the Segunda Division B level and even ranked third in the Segunda Division A. These feats reflect the quality of players groomed at Barcelona B FC and their influence on Spanish football.

The Impact of Barcelona B FC on Spanish Football

Barcelona B FC‘s imprint on Spanish football is profound. Its dedication to nurturing local talent has substantially bolstered Spanish football’s prowess. Numerous Barcelona B FC alumni have gone on to represent Spain at various stages, playing instrumental roles in the nation’s international triumphs.
